Understanding HDR Technology and Its Benefits
High Dynamic Range technology enhances the visual performance of laptops, providing richer colors and better contrast. Here's how it benefits students:
1. Enhanced Visual Quality: HDR technology allows for a wider color range and better contrast, making images appear more lifelike and immersive.
2. Improved Productivity: Students benefit from vibrant displays, making visual content clearer and easier to work with, which can lead to higher quality projects.
3. Suitable for Creative Tasks: HDR laptops are ideal for graphic design, video editing, and gaming, catering specifically to the needs of creative students.
4. Energy Efficiency: Many HDR laptops are designed with energy-efficient technologies, ensuring longer battery life during intense usage.
5. Future-Ready Technology: Investing in HDR displays prepares students for professional environments that increasingly demand high-quality visual outputs.
6. Versatile Use Cases: These laptops not only enhance academic performance but are also perfect for gaming and multimedia consumption outside of schoolwork.

Which laptop should a design student buy for HDR work?
Choose the Dell XPS 15 OLED for designers: it has a 15.6-inch 4K OLED display and an average rating of 4.6, with Intel Core i7 or i9 options for strong high-performance needs.
What HDR display spec does the MacBook Pro 16 M2 Max offer?
The Apple MacBook Pro 16 M2 Max includes a 16-inch Liquid Retina XDR display, and its average rating is 4.8.
How does the Dell XPS 15 OLED price compare here?
The Dell XPS 15 OLED is listed at $3599 CAD, while the Apple MacBook Pro 16 M2 Max costs $5399.99 CAD and the HP Spectre x360 16 OLED costs $1542.63 CAD.
Does the HP Spectre x360 16 OLED support stylus use?
Yes—the HP Spectre x360 16 OLED includes stylus support for creative tasks, has an average rating of 4.5, and features a versatile 360-degree hinge.
